From e8db743ca973183c72b064ef7e9f408eb1c70543 Mon Sep 17 00:00:00 2001 From: "jam@chromium.org" Date: Tue, 12 Apr 2011 18:33:07 +0000 Subject: Chrome side needed for WebKit change to move the little remaining spellcheck code out of RenderView. Review URL: http://codereview.chromium.org/6813090 git-svn-id: svn://svn.chromium.org/chrome/trunk/src@81274 0039d316-1c4b-4281-b951-d872f2087c98 --- webkit/glue/context_menu.cc | 8 ++++++++ 1 file changed, 8 insertions(+) (limited to 'webkit/glue') diff --git a/webkit/glue/context_menu.cc b/webkit/glue/context_menu.cc index 317130e..0d68c03 100644 --- a/webkit/glue/context_menu.cc +++ b/webkit/glue/context_menu.cc @@ -5,6 +5,9 @@ #include "webkit/glue/context_menu.h" #include "webkit/glue/glue_serialize.h" +// TODO(jam): remove me once WebKit is merged. +#include "third_party/WebKit/Source/WebKit/chromium/public/WebSpellCheckClient.h" + namespace webkit_glue { const int32 CustomContextMenuContext::kCurrentRenderWidget = kint32max; @@ -43,6 +46,11 @@ ContextMenuParams::ContextMenuParams(const WebKit::WebContextMenuData& data) edit_flags(data.editFlags), security_info(data.securityInfo), frame_charset(data.frameEncoding.utf8()) { +#if defined(WEBSPELLCHECKCLIENT_HAS_SUGGESTIONS) + for (size_t i = 0; i < data.dictionarySuggestions.size(); ++i) + dictionary_suggestions.push_back(data.dictionarySuggestions[i]); +#endif + custom_context.is_pepper_menu = false; for (size_t i = 0; i < data.customItems.size(); ++i) custom_items.push_back(WebMenuItem(data.customItems[i])); -- cgit v1.1